Physical activity does have an impact on the likelihood of one to develop a disease but it depends on the type of disease. Performing exercises such as running, swimming or aerobic dance can reduce the risk of developing certain heart diseases and joint diseases but in the case of some cancers or hereditary diseases physical activity is not helpful in reducing the likelihood.

True. The community environment where one lives can greatly impact their physical activity levels. Factors like access to parks, sidewalks, recreational facilities, and safe neighborhoods can influence the likelihood of engaging in physical activity.
Nutrition, genetics, hormonal balance, and physical activity can all influence the skeleton proportions and growth of long bones during adolescence. Proper nutrition and hormonal balance are essential for healthy bone development, while genetics can play a significant role in determining an individual's bone structure. Physical activity, especially weight-bearing exercises, can also impact bone growth by stimulating bone formation and strength.
Yes, social connections can significantly impact physical activity. People are more likely to engage in regular exercise when they have social support or workout partners, fostering accountability and motivation.

Behavior plays a crucial role in physical fitness levels as it influences exercise habits, dietary choices, and overall lifestyle. Regular physical activity and healthy eating patterns are often driven by personal motivation, goals, and social influences. Additionally, behaviors such as prioritizing rest and recovery can also impact fitness outcomes. Ultimately, consistent positive behaviors contribute significantly to achieving and maintaining optimal physical fitness.

Fluctuations in a person's activity level can occur due to various factors, including changes in physical health, motivation, environmental influences, and lifestyle choices. Increased activity can lead to enhanced energy levels and improved mood, while decreased activity may result from fatigue, stress, or other commitments. Additionally, external factors like seasonal changes or social engagements can also impact how active a person feels. Overall, these dynamics create a natural ebb and flow in activity levels.
